Music at Bray
www.braystmichael.co.uk/music_at_bray.htm
Music at Bray organises free chamber music recitals on the second Sunday of each month at St Michael's Church, Church Drive, Bray. The concerts begin at 3pm and last 40 minutes and are followed by tea served in St Michael's Hall.

St Michael's Hall
The hall is situated within the grounds of the church and is available for functions associated with the church, for up to 60 people, including weddings, funerals, etc. Contact the vicar, the Rev George Repath, on 01628 633113.

Afternoon teas are available in the Hall every Sunday afternoon from 3.30pm to 5pm during the summer. Anyone welcome to come.
